Package org.openurp.edu.program.model
Class SharePlan
java.lang.Object
org.beangle.commons.entity.pojo.NumberIdObject<Long>
org.beangle.commons.entity.pojo.LongIdObject
org.openurp.edu.program.model.SharePlan
- All Implemented Interfaces:
Serializable,Cloneable,org.beangle.commons.entity.Entity<Long>
@Entity(name="org.openurp.edu.program.model.SharePlan")
public class SharePlan
extends org.beangle.commons.entity.pojo.LongIdObject
implements Cloneable
公共共享计划
- See Also:
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ected Date创建时间protected List<ShareCourseGroup>共享课程组protected Date最后修改时间Fields inherited from class org.beangle.commons.entity.pojo.NumberIdObject
id -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idaddGroup(ShareCourseGroup group) clone()getEndOn()getLevel()getName()voidsetBeginOn(Date beginOn) voidsetCreatedAt(Date createdAt) voidvoidsetFromGrade(Grade fromGrade) voidsetGroups(List<ShareCourseGroup> groups) voidsetLevel(EducationLevel level) voidvoidsetProject(Project project) voidvoidsetToGrade(Grade toGrade) voidsetUpdatedAt(Date updatedAt) Methods inherited from class org.beangle.commons.entity.pojo.NumberIdObject
equals, getId, hashCode, isPersisted, isTransient, setId
-
Field Details
-
groups
共享课程组 -
createdAt
创建时间 -
updatedAt
最后修改时间
-
-
Constructor Details
-
SharePlan
public SharePlan()
-
-
Method Details
-
getUpdatedAt
-
setUpdatedAt
-
getTopCourseGroups
-
clone
- Overrides:
clonein classObject- Throws:
CloneNotSupportedException
-
getName
-
setName
-
getLevel
-
setLevel
-
getGroups
-
setGroups
-
getBeginOn
-
setBeginOn
-
getEndOn
-
setEndOn
-
getProject
-
setProject
-
getCreatedAt
-
setCreatedAt
-
getFromGrade
-
setFromGrade
-
getToGrade
-
setToGrade
-
getRemark
-
setRemark
-